Adjusting LK68 with Targeted Tasks

LK68 is a powerful language model with broad capabilities. However, fine-tuning it for targeted tasks can dramatically improve its performance. This involves training the model on a smaller dataset relevant to the desired task. By doing so, you can improve LK68's ability to produce {moreaccurate outputs for your specific needs.

  • Instances of adjusting LK68 include conditioning it to summarize text, convert languages, or compose different kinds of creative content.
  • Customizing LK68 demands careful determination of the training dataset and appropriate hyperparameters.

Moral Considerations in Utilizing LK68

The utilization of LK68, a powerful language model, raises a number of ethical considerations. One important concern is the potential for bias in its outputs. As with any AI trained on vast datasets, LK68 may amplify societal biases present in the data, leading to harmful predictions. Another concern is the potential for exploitation. Malicious actors website could leverage LK68 to create harmful content, such as propaganda, which could have serious impacts. It is therefore essential to develop and implement robust ethical guidelines and safeguards to reduce these risks and ensure that LK68 is used responsibly and for the advancement of society.
